Politely Negative Impressions of the 3D
Typically, not inherently. The lowest latency wireless controllers (Gulikit ES/ES Pro, Dualsense Edge) all use Bluetooth not 2.4ghz. In this case though 8bitdo controllers in general are not amazing for latency. And we don't know what's being added on the 3D side.
